I’m not saying these movies are bad. Far from it. They just lean heavily on their visual prowess. They’re the equivalent of a supermodel who can also sing. Impressive on multiple levels, but you might be there for the looks first.

Take Avatar. Yes, yes, the story. But the world! Pandora is just… wow. You could watch that movie on mute and still be entertained by the sheer visual artistry. The floating mountains! The bioluminescent forests! It’s an absolute spectacle.

Or Blade Runner 2049. The cinematography in that film is just chef’s kiss. Every frame is a painting. It’s so atmospheric and moody, you can practically feel the rain on your face. Even when Ryan Gosling is just walking, it’s an event.

Then there are those animated films that look like moving oil paintings. Think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se. That movie is a pure explosion of creative visual design. It’s like a comic book came to life and then went to art school.

And what about the historical epics? The ones with impossibly detailed costumes and grand sets. You can practically smell the 17th-century dust. They make you feel like you’ve stepped back in time. Even if the dialogue sounds like it was written by a history textbook.
